Emthias Abdul Salam - PeerSpot reviewer
Offers a valuable single sign-on feature and a user-friendly interface with outstanding scaling capabilities
The single sign-on feature, which integrates with the Identity Manager is one of the most vital features. The VMware Workspace ONE Tunnel is another crucial aspect of the solution. Authentication processes become seamless with the single sign-on feature of VMware Workspace ONE. Whether the application resides within the premises or outside, the users don't need to reenter the credentials, VMware Workspace ONE auto authenticates using scripts. The solution can also integrate the app catalog with the Intelligent Hub, which acts as the agent. Applications catalogs and similar aspects can be accessed through one single interface, whether it's from an Android, iOS, or Windows device. It's a very user-friendly tool in terms of accessibility.

"One of the features that I enjoyed most was the integration with Azure AD because I could use VMware Identity Manager to standardize the User Principal Name coming from Active Directory. You have Azure AD Connect to do that. In between, if you have vIDM handling it, you can easily get the synchronization of users into your VM and standardize the User Principal Name. If you require quality assurance for handling it, you can actually count on the vIDM to do so. That was one of the main things I enjoyed about the product."
